Technical Breakdown: What Makes 10kWh Work

Modern systems like Huawei’s Luna 2.0 use lithium iron phosphate (LFP) chemistry – the same tech protecting your smartphone from sudden shutdowns, but scaled up. Here’s why it matters:

Metric Lead-Acid 10kWh LFP
Cycle Life 500-800 6,000+
Depth of Discharge 50% 90%

Installation Reality Check

“Wait, no – it’s not just plug-and-play!” Proper installation requires certified technicians to handle:

  1. Wall/Ceiling load assessments
  2. Thermal management configurations
  3. Smart inverter synchronization
